Domain-driven design (DDD) is a major software design approach, [1] focusing on modeling software to match a domain according to input from that domain's experts. [2] DDD is against the idea of having a single unified model; instead it divides a large system into bounded contexts, each of which have their own model.

It is important for an event storming workshop to have the right people present. This includes people who know the questions to ask (typically developers) and those who know the answers (domain experts, product owners). Sample domain model for a health insurance plan. In software engineering, a domain model is a conceptual model of the domain that incorporates both behavior and data. [1] [2] In ontology engineering, a domain model is a formal representation of a knowledge domain with concepts, roles, datatypes, individuals, and rules, typically grounded in a description logic.
Model-driven architecture (MDA) is a software design approach for the development of software systems. It provides a set of guidelines for the structuring of specifications, which are expressed as models. Model Driven Architecture is a kind of domain engineering, and supports model-driven engineering of software systems.
Domain engineering, is the entire process of reusing domain knowledge in the production of new software systems. It is a key concept in systematic software reuse and product line engineering. A key idea in systematic software reuse is the domain. Most organizations work in only a few domains.
Feature-driven development is built on a core set of software engineering best practices aimed at a client-valued feature perspective. Domain object modelling. Domain object modeling consists of exploring and explaining the domain of the problem to be solved. The resulting domain object model provides an overall framework in which to add features.
